Hyalopeziza-like on Fagus
Marc Detollenaere, 21-12-2024 12:45
Marc DetollenaereDear Forum,

On naked wood of Fagus, I found some hairy discs with dark hymenium.The hairs were whitish,partially glassy, septated and cylindric .
Spores were cylindric, 8.3-9x2.3-2.9µ and contained 2 guttules.IKI reaction apical apparatus was positive (blue).Hyalopeziza seemed to be close.
Andgelo Mombert suggested Cenangium of H alnicola .
Any suggestions? Hyalopeziza valesiaca?

Hans-Otto Baral, 22-12-2024 18:46
Hans-Otto Baral
Re : Hyalopeziza-like on Fagus
C. alnicola is a fungus with long brownish hairs, resembling a Lasiobelonium.

Hans-Otto Baral, 24-12-2024 09:41
Hans-Otto Baral
Re : Hyalopeziza-like on Fagus
Dematioscypha has longer hairs and inamyloid asci (except for D. castaneae).

I would rather search in Psilocistella (quercina).
